Growing Closer to God with Guided Meditation
Growing Closer to God with Guided Meditation is a daily Christian devotional and meditation podcast designed to help you slow down, breathe deeply, and experience God’s presence in a personal, peaceful way.
Each week begins with a guided Christian meditation, followed by five daily devotionals that explore Scripture, prayer, and spiritual formation through a calm, reflective rhythm.
You’ll find meditations for anxiety, rest, grief, spiritual direction, hearing God’s voice, and emotional healing — along with practical devotionals that help you walk with Jesus in everyday life.
The podcast also includes teaching conversations and micro‑church formation episodes for listeners who want to grow as spiritual leaders, disciple-makers, or house church planters.
Whether you’re beginning your day, winding down at night, or seeking a moment of quiet with God, these meditations and devotionals create space for peace, clarity, and deeper intimacy with Jesus. If you’re longing for a simple, Scripture-centered way to connect with God, this podcast offers a gentle, steady companion for your spiritual journey.
